Reeves Ready for 'Night Watchmen'
Ellroy scripted film begins in April
Is it just me or does it seem like Keanu Reeves has been off the radar for years? Personally I was one of the select few that actually enjoyed The Lake House, but even still just seeing the last name "Reeves" would have triggered Keanu about a year ago but now it took me a minute.
Nevertheless, Neo is back as Reeves is set to star in The Night Watchmen for director David Ayer.
The pic was penned by James Ellroy in which Reeves plays a cop who's always done what was needed to solve homicides and crack down on gang violence until he gets a wakeup call and decides he can no longer play the game that made him so effective.
The project had been in limbo over at Paramount for a couple years with names like Spike Lee and Oliver Stone circling it but Fox Searchlight/New Regency got their hands on it, brought on Ayer and the rest is today's news. Production begins April 30 after Ayer does a rewrite on the script. Ayer recently wrote and directed the Christian Bale starrer Harsh Times.
